Between Bites is a new food-related storytelling series featuring local writers or personalities and benefiting a local cause—in this case Un86’d, which helps hospitality professionals with medical bills or other needs. The theme of the first event is Food Firsts; the writers reading will be Anthony Todd (Chicagoist), Ari Bendersky (Crain‘s), Chandra Ram (Plate), Heather Sperling (Tasting Table Chicago), Joe Campagna (Chicago Food Snob) and Kiki Luthringshausen (Beautyandherfeast.com). It’s at Two restaurant tonight and starts at 6:30 PM; tickets are $20 here and include appetizers and wine, plus a cash bar.
Little Market Brasserie has been raising money for Meals on Wheels with its Melts for Meals campaign, featuring celebrity-designed grilled cheese sandwiches whose sale benefits the organization. You’ve got a few days left to try Chandra Ram’s (her again!) southern-style grilled cheese with bacon, pimento cheese, tomatoes, and arugula; then on October 1 it’s Sepia chef Andrew Zimmerman’s ham and gjetost grilled cheese for the rest of the month.
